Check Prerequisites
The Prerequisite Checker verifies that your machine meets IaaS installation requirements.
Prerequisites
Select the Installation Type.
Procedure
1 Complete the Prerequisite Check.
Option Description
No errors Click Next.
Noncritical errors Click Bypass.
Critical errors Bypassing critical errors causes the installation to fail. If warnings appear, select
the warning in the left pane and follow the instructions on the right. Address all
critical errors and click Check Again to verify.
2 Click Next.
The machine meets installation requirements.
Specify Server and Account Settings
The vRealize Automation system administrator specifies server and account settings for the Windows
installation server and selects a SQL database server instance and authentication method.
Prerequisites
Check Prerequisites.
Procedure
1 On the Server and Account Settings page or the Detected Settings page, enter the user name and
password for the Windows service account. This service account must be a local administrator
account that also has SQL administrative privileges.
2 Type a phrase in the Passphrase text box.
The passphrase is a series of words that generates the encryption key used to secure database data.
Note Save your passphrase so that it is available for future installations or system recovery.
3 To install the database instance on the same server with the IaaS components, accept the default
server in the Server text box in the SQL Server Database Installation Information section.
If the database is on a different machine, enter the server in the following format.
machine-FQDN,port-number\named-database-instance
